The ocean route from Memphis to Rotterdam offers significant advantages for transporting pharmaceuticals. This passage allows for the bulk shipment of medicines, ensuring that large quantities can be delivered efficiently and economically. Additionally, maritime transport is ideal for maintaining the integrity of medical drugs, as it provides a stable environment during transit, which is crucial for sensitive pharmaceutical goods. The established maritime logistics networks also facilitate seamless access to global markets, enhancing distribution capabilities.
Memphis boasts a robust infrastructure with advanced warehousing and distribution facilities tailored for the pharmaceutical sector. The city's strategic location provides easy access to major highways and railways, ensuring efficient connections to ports. In Rotterdam, the port is equipped with state-of-the-art handling systems designed specifically for pharmaceuticals, including temperature-controlled storage and monitoring systems. This infrastructure supports the safe and effective movement of medical products across Europe and beyond.

Anticipate potential delays due to North America winter storms (December-March) by building in buffer days and flexible delivery windows. Arrange vessel space and inland transport well in advance during the holiday retail surge (mid-November to early December) to avoid congestion. Additionally, monitor carriers for real-time updates on weather disruptions (November-March) and adjust routing plans as necessary to ensure timely delivery.

Transporting temperature-sensitive Pharma products Requires tested thermal shippers, suitable refrigerants, and Continuous temperature monitoring. Specify an express service where possible, Pre-condition gel packs, and Add a data logger in the carton to verify that medical drugs stayed within their labeled temperature range.
Fragile glass vials of pharmaceutical goods Should be packed in Molded trays with 360-degree padding. Set trays inside a Rigid outer carton and stabilize using void-fill so nothing moves. For moisture-sensitive medical drugs, Combine this with moisture-barrier inner bags and desiccants.
International shipments of medical drugs typically Require a detailed commercial invoice, packing list, and any Licenses required by the importing country. Most regulated markets also ask for Certificates of Analysis, proof of GDP-compliant handling, and clear temperature instructions for cold-chain medicines. Always confirm requirements with your customs broker before shipping.
For moisture-sensitive pharmaceutical goods, Use Foil-laminate pouches plus desiccant sachets inside the packaging. Secure cartons tightly, avoid damaged boxes, and select transport options that Limit exposure to rain and high humidity, such as covered docks and climate-controlled linehaul for medical drugs.
High-value medical drugs Benefit from Specialized cargo insurance that covers temperature excursions, breakage, and theft. Consult an insurer familiar with pharmaceutical goods, specify the full replacement value, and Keep temperature and handling records so claims can be processed efficiently if something goes wrong.
Pharmaceuticals require temperature-controlled environments during transport to maintain their efficacy. It is essential to utilize refrigerated containers and monitor temperature throughout the journey. Additionally, securing the cargo properly to prevent damage during transit is crucial.
Shipping pharmaceuticals requires specific documentation, including a commercial invoice, packing list, and any necessary certificates of analysis or compliance with EU regulations. It is also important to provide import permits for pharmaceuticals as mandated by Dutch authorities.
